To our awareness, Proteinase K can't be totally warmth-inactivated. Even if incubating at ninety five°C for ten minutes, some enzymatic action continues to be. This tends to not negatively have an effect on the QIAamp Procedure, given that the enzyme will probably be competently taken out by the wash ways while in the protocols.

EDTA chelates divalent cations which can be required for nuclease activity. When the genomic DNA (gDNA) extracted utilizing QIAGEN products and solutions, should not have any nuclease activity, it is achievable to introduce nucleases during repeated extended-expression obtain of the DNA. EDTA aids to forestall any nuclease action released once the genomic DNA extraction procedures. Having said that, When the gDNA is stored frozen at -20oC or -80oC, nuclease exercise is way reduced.
